Is it possible to provide different URLs for ulinks depending on whether I am using a
print or html stylesheet? I don't want to do this for all ulinks, just select ones. I
am picturing something like:
<ulink url="printurl.com" type="print">Somewhere</ulink>
<ulink url="htmlurl.com" type="html">Somewhere Else</ulink>
where only one of these would generate a link, depending on the backend. Is there an
existing attribute for differentiating print and html markup?
My application is that I would like to provide links to Amazon and B&N for books in
the html version of my bibliography, but not in the print version. I want to make such
a distincion only in the bibliography, i.e. I would like these particular ulinks to be
active only in html.
